地址:北京市密云區(qū)高嶺鎮(zhèn)政府辦公樓
王經(jīng)理 13393261468
Q Q:514468705/1049705527
郵箱:jhcxkj@163.com
為滿足世界各地的數(shù)據(jù)交互需求,數(shù)據(jù)中心會(huì)將機(jī)房建在世界的各個(gè)角落,也就是說(shuō)一個(gè)數(shù)據(jù)中心會(huì)有多個(gè)機(jī)房與其聯(lián)通。一定會(huì)有人認(rèn)為一個(gè)地區(qū)建立了一個(gè)數(shù)據(jù)中心就可以輻射全部了,那你就太天真啦。試想如果在北京建立了一個(gè)數(shù)據(jù)中心,一位在廣東的用戶要與其進(jìn)行交互,那傳輸速度都要望穿秋水了。
把機(jī)房部署到各地為的是滿足全球各地用戶訪問(wèn)的需求,可以提升本地用戶的訪問(wèn)體驗(yàn),也可以作為機(jī)房的業(yè)務(wù)備份,也可以是集群業(yè)務(wù)擴(kuò)容的需要。盡管數(shù)據(jù)中心跨機(jī)房建設(shè)也比較受親賴,同時(shí)它也存在著一些不可避免的問(wèn)題。因此不管在部署什么的業(yè)務(wù),做跨機(jī)房的時(shí)候,都要充分考慮以下可能面臨的問(wèn)題,以便在跨機(jī)房部署時(shí)降低風(fēng)險(xiǎn)。
機(jī)房出入口帶寬決定可行性
想要打通處于不同地區(qū)的兩個(gè)或者多個(gè)機(jī)房,很多時(shí)候要經(jīng)過(guò)廣域網(wǎng)才行。通常情況下是向運(yùn)營(yíng)商租用帶寬,通過(guò)在兩個(gè)機(jī)房之間建立一條VPN隧道,達(dá)到打通的目的,這個(gè)帶寬大小要根據(jù)機(jī)房的實(shí)際需要,也要考慮運(yùn)營(yíng)商能提供多大的帶寬。原則上,能進(jìn)行本地機(jī)房轉(zhuǎn)發(fā)的,盡量不走跨機(jī)房,減少跨機(jī)房的流量負(fù)擔(dān),這樣可以減少租用運(yùn)營(yíng)商網(wǎng)絡(luò)帶寬的費(fèi)用。
機(jī)房的建設(shè)不要過(guò)于分散,減少機(jī)房之間的通道,各地機(jī)房都要匯聚連接到大規(guī)模的機(jī)房上,運(yùn)營(yíng)商的網(wǎng)絡(luò)帶寬各地均有不同,機(jī)房要盡量建設(shè)在網(wǎng)絡(luò)發(fā)到的地區(qū),以免運(yùn)營(yíng)商帶寬大大地限制住跨機(jī)房的流量訪問(wèn)。做跨機(jī)房的業(yè)務(wù)部署時(shí),首先就要考慮機(jī)房出入口的帶寬是否能滿足,如果不能滿足,一票否決,這樣的跨機(jī)房業(yè)務(wù)不能建設(shè)和部署。
關(guān)鍵數(shù)據(jù)不要跨機(jī)房反復(fù)傳遞
在數(shù)據(jù)中心機(jī)房?jī)?nèi)部,可以部署各種軟硬件的安全防護(hù)措施,以確保數(shù)據(jù)安全。但機(jī)房之間的數(shù)據(jù)交互,這些數(shù)據(jù)就不受機(jī)房的控制了,在廣域網(wǎng)傳輸時(shí),數(shù)據(jù)中心機(jī)房的安全難以發(fā)揮作用。各種廣域網(wǎng)的網(wǎng)絡(luò)協(xié)議本身是存在安全漏洞的,萬(wàn)一發(fā)生攻擊,被人攻破利用,數(shù)據(jù)就會(huì)泄密,帶來(lái)的損失可能是致命性的。
在機(jī)房之間要盡量傳遞計(jì)算數(shù)據(jù)或者中間過(guò)程數(shù)據(jù),對(duì)于一些涉及個(gè)人信息或者商業(yè)機(jī)密的數(shù)據(jù),盡量不要在跨機(jī)房的業(yè)務(wù)中反復(fù)傳遞,即使要傳遞,也盡量采用線下的方式。通過(guò)人為拷貝到存儲(chǔ)設(shè)備中,比如U盤,移動(dòng)硬盤,PC等,在機(jī)房之間轉(zhuǎn)移和傳遞,減少數(shù)據(jù)在網(wǎng)絡(luò)中傳輸泄露的風(fēng)險(xiǎn)。
確保數(shù)據(jù)的平滑交接
在進(jìn)行業(yè)務(wù)部署的時(shí)候要充分考慮跨機(jī)房的延時(shí)問(wèn)題,數(shù)據(jù)中心內(nèi)部網(wǎng)絡(luò)通信延時(shí)一般在300us(0.3ms)左右,但跨機(jī)房通信延時(shí)可能高達(dá)50000us(50ms)。不同的業(yè)務(wù)延時(shí)不同,這就需要工作人員根據(jù)延時(shí)的時(shí)間來(lái)確定主備系統(tǒng)的數(shù)據(jù)差異,避免數(shù)據(jù)發(fā)生紊亂。尤其是在進(jìn)行主備切換時(shí),一定要確保數(shù)據(jù)的平滑交接,不出現(xiàn)丟失數(shù)據(jù)的情況。
虛擬機(jī)要實(shí)現(xiàn)跨機(jī)房的遷移就需要部署一個(gè)大二層的網(wǎng)絡(luò),而傳統(tǒng)的數(shù)據(jù)中心機(jī)房?jī)?nèi)部都是全三層轉(zhuǎn)發(fā)的,現(xiàn)在要通過(guò)二層打通,就需要借助VXLAN技術(shù),構(gòu)建一套虛擬的網(wǎng)絡(luò),實(shí)現(xiàn)虛擬機(jī)在機(jī)房之間任意遷移。延時(shí)過(guò)大,就會(huì)影響到遷移的速度,在虛擬機(jī)技術(shù)實(shí)現(xiàn)上也要充分考慮到延時(shí)的影響。
想盡辦法克服抖動(dòng)
跨機(jī)房的整個(gè)通信鏈路中,對(duì)設(shè)計(jì)方案的穩(wěn)定性要求很高,因?yàn)槿魏我稽c(diǎn)發(fā)生變化,都可能帶來(lái)整條鏈路的通信抖動(dòng),又由于中間要經(jīng)過(guò)太多的鏈路和網(wǎng)絡(luò)設(shè)備,因此很難排查,這些設(shè)備還可能分屬于不同的運(yùn)營(yíng)商或不同地區(qū),偶爾網(wǎng)絡(luò)抖動(dòng),一般數(shù)據(jù)中心機(jī)房也只只能是啞巴吃黃連。
可見抖動(dòng)是不可避免的,所以我們需要想辦法克服抖動(dòng)。在機(jī)房之間跑的網(wǎng)絡(luò)協(xié)議,重傳機(jī)制和超時(shí)時(shí)間要設(shè)置得長(zhǎng)一些,對(duì)抖動(dòng)不敏感。比如在端口上,可以增加延遲DOWN或UP的配置,當(dāng)出現(xiàn)鏈路抖動(dòng)或者錯(cuò)包時(shí),只要不超過(guò)設(shè)定的時(shí)間,端口都不會(huì)DOWN。因?yàn)槎丝贒OWN了后,很多協(xié)議和流量就徹底中斷了,而通過(guò)延遲DOWN配置就可避免抖動(dòng)帶來(lái)端口DOWN,減少對(duì)跨機(jī)房流量轉(zhuǎn)發(fā)影響。